Product Overview

The Barrett MRAD SMR is a precision-oriented bolt-action rifle chambered in .300 Norma Mag. Built as a simplified Single Mission Rifle configuration, it uses a fixed tactical stock, free-float barrel, adjustable cheek piece, and length-of-pull spacers for a stable and adaptable shooting position. Its Tungsten Cerakote factory finish is represented in the product finish data as Gray. A full-length top rail provides a solid foundation for adding a compatible optic, while the threaded 26-inch barrel supports muzzle-device or suppressor installation. The rifle feeds from a detachable ten-round magazine and delivers the rugged modular design associated with the MRAD family.

Key Features

  • .300 Norma Mag chambering for long-range precision applications
  • 26-inch free-float barrel with a 1:9.4 twist rate
  • Fixed tactical stock with adjustable cheek piece and length-of-pull spacers
  • Full-length top rail for mounting a compatible optic
  • Thumb-operated manual safety for positive user control
  • Threaded muzzle for compatible muzzle devices or suppressors
